Tortoise SubWCRev.exe自定义关键字

时间:2015-08-21 12:24:51

标签: svn tortoisesvn

目前正在使用Tortoise和SubWCRev.exe对我的项目进行版本化,如下所示:

  

[assembly:AssemblyVersion(“1.3.0.0”)]

     

[assembly:AssemblyFileVersion(“1.3。$ WCDATE =%y%m $。$ WCREV $”)]

但是我想用一个特定的数字来改变BuildNr,比如12 ... 13 ... 14 ......所以它看起来像1.3.12.21432或其他什么。

所以问题是:是否可以添加一些自定义关键字或参数?或者还有其他解决方案吗? 我们正在使用Jenkins来构建我们的项目。

1 个答案:

答案 0 :(得分:1)

如果BuildNr必须是一些递增的数字,你可以

  1. 使用$WCREV-$ SubWCRev的默认关键字和一些" base"修订为零点。对于构建"关于源变更"您将增加WC的修订并增加REV-BASE
  2. 您可以手动构建AssemblyVersion附加脚本并使用defined by Jenkins environment variable BUILD_NUMBER